  • the present invention relates to a functional fiber for preventing forgery, more particularly functional fiber for preventing forgery which exerts functionality by mixing special pigments to composite fibers of side by side shape on which two components are attached.
  • a proposed technique as a functional fiber for preventing forgery in conventional art may be described as followings;
  • a fiber having fluorescence functionality has been produced by using method which produces a fiber by melting or dispersing fluorescent pigment or fluorescent dye whose external color is white or colored into synthetic resins for a fiber and then ejecting the resultant mixture, or fixing fluorescent dye on a surface of fiber with reaction, or preparing paints or inks with fluorescent pigment or fluorescent dye and then painting and coating the obtained paints or inks on a fiber.
  • Japanese patent early publication No. Sho 63-196719 (1988) Japanese patent early publication No. Sho 63-165517 (1988) and Japanese patent early publication No. Pyung 2-200811 (1990) can be presented.
  • the paper produced by adding a monofilament obtained from such fiber having fluorescence functionality in a paper-procedure can not be observed in naked eye, the monofilament can be easily observed provided that the produced paper is exposed under a fluorescent lamp, namely ultra violet, because it is excited, so that it functions effect for preventing forgery by differentiation from conventional papers.
  • Korean patent registration No. 0109762 discloses a fiber for preventing forgery that displays a visual colors different with a fluorescent colors by the first pigmentation and then the second pigmentation with a fluorescent dye which is expressed whit the other color.
  • Korean patent registration No. 0259825 discloses a fiber for preventing forgery which produces a thread with strips of many colors of shape of a cloth with strips of many colors by cutting the fiber that is obtained as a state of one whose inside is not dyed and whose outside is dyed by pigmentation at state twisted a mix-treaded fiber.
  • Korean patent registration No. 0363720 discloses a fiber for preventing forgery which displays fluorescent radiation when being outside stimulus such as exposure of ultra violet and displays phosphorescent radiation when being removed an outside stimulus, since the said fiber includes all phosphorescent matters and fluorescent maters having a different radiating wavelength from each other, and whose appearance is with white color or without any colors.
  • Korean patent registration No. 0407251 discloses a two colored single fiber which is produced to be differentiated a central color with a color of the both end by removing an inside ingredient with dissolving it only by dipping a short fiber into a solvent which dissolve only an inside ingredient, the said short fiber being obtained by preparing a composite fiber of sheath-core type consisted of an outside ingredient and an inside ingredient.
  • the above mentioned functional fiber have been all a fiber type obtained by one-axial weaving (monofilament), and its functionality or each feature is allowed by mixing colored pigments, fluorescent pigments and the like during a procedure of producing a fiber, or by dyeing and pigmentation during a procedure after producing a fiber.
  • the method of manufacturing a composite fiber has been developed to endow a winding property for a fiber that is a side by side type being relevant to the present invention.
  • the proposed technique may be described as followings to relate to the above method;
  • Korean patent registration No. 0234558 discloses a mixed yarn having different shrinkage having a touch sensation of an micro powder by mix-treading a undrawn yarn of two type polyester whose spinning velocity is different each other
  • Korean patent registration No. 0245664 discloses a fiber having an excellent interface adhesive property which is interlocked a part of one component with the other component between the interface of two component with improvement of a ejaculating device for spinning when producing a composite fiber of a side by side type.
  • Korean patent registration No. 0602284 (title; Preparation of side by side type polyester composite fiber and side by side type polyester composite fiber) discloses a composite fiber which resolves a high-angle firing problem at spinning and further has an excellent winding property without improvement of a spinning device by mix-spinning a polymer of two kinds whose intrinsic viscosity are different each other
  • Korean patent registration No. 0429364 (title; Method for manufacturing dibasic polyester-conjugated yarn having improved size stability) discloses a fiber having a good dibasic effect and improved size stability by mix-spinning two components of basic dye dying polyester and basic dye non-dying polyester
  • Korean patent registration No. 0259825 discloses a fiber for preventing forgery which produces a thread with strips of many colors of shape of a cloth with strips of many colors by cutting the fiber that is obtained as a state of one whose inside is not dyed and whose outside is dyed by pigmentation at state twisted a mix-treaded fiber, and a monofilament occasionally shows a shape of ⁇ due to a dyeing process by a mix-treaded fiber.
  • the above described techniques have an object that the composite fibers of a side by side type on which two components are attached is to improve property of fibers for textiles such as winding property, interface adhesive property, touch sensation, size stability and the like.

  • the present invention relates to a functional fiber for preventing forgery which exerts functionality by mixing special pigments to composite fibers of side by side type on which two components are attached, wherein it can have a functionality which make to represent a visual differentiation, fluorescent emitting colors and absorbance of infrared ray by applying colored pigments, fluorescent pigments, infrared pigments and the like to each component of fibers with different combined rate.
  • the composite fibers of side by side type, a constituent element of the present invention may be produced by using a conventional well-known art, and two components are described with ‘the first ingredient’ and ‘the second ingredient’ to illustrate easily.
  • the fiber is circular shape and area and form of its right and left side may be differently formed.
  • the first ingredient and the second ingredient corresponding to each component of left and right side are consisted of the same or combined different, respectably, and the said combination may be selected according to a property of a special pigment being mixed to fibers.
  • a functional fiber of two components of the present invention it is preferable for a functional fiber of two components of the present invention to have a melting property since it is prepared by synthetic high molecules and a special pigment being mixed and dispersed and then melt-spinning.
  • thermoplastic synthetic high molecules is preferable which is molten by heating to high temperature and solidified by returning at low temperature, and it may include polyester, nylon, polypropylene, polyethylene, polyurethane and the like.
  • melt-spinning in case of using a different one for the first ingredient and the second ingredient, it is preferable for melt-spinning to select those that have an excellent inter-solubility between the first ingredient and the second ingredient and an interfacial adhesive property.
  • pigments such as colored pigments, fluorescent pigments, infrared pigments and the like can be without limitation, it is preferable to use those whose heat resistance is excellent up to extent not to change its property at melting point of selected synthetic high molecules for fibers.
  • a fluorescent material such as Kalcoseads, Kalcomins, Kalcozeans, Rhodamines and Lumogens may be used, and it is a pigment whose external appearance has color and which emit a fluorescence same with an external color.
  • a fluorescent material of metal oxide series such Sr(PO 2 )CI:Eu (blue emitting), Zn 2 GeO 2 :Mn (green emitting), Y 2 O 2 S:Eu (red emitting) and the like, which emit various fluorescence and its external appearance is invisible color, e.g. white color.
  • fluorescent pigment may be illustrated in further details as followings; most of a fluorescent material generally has any colors or white color under visual light and displays a fluorescent property by being excited by 365 nm, long wavelength under a commercially available ultraviolet ray lamp. But, several special fluorescent materials display a property that is excited only ultraviolet ray of long wavelength or only ultraviolet ray of short wavelength.
  • fluorescent materials which is excited at ultraviolet ray of long wavelength may include trade name Lumilux® CD-702 (green color, 520 nm) of Honeywell company and trade name D-034 (off yellow color, 507 nm), IPO-13 (red color, 620 nm), IPO-15 (orange color, 590 nm), IPO-19 (blue color, 450 nm) of DAYGLO's company, and a chemical composition is Y 2 O 2 S:Eu (red color), Zn 2 GeO 4 :Mn (green color), 3(Ba,Mg) O.8 Al 2 O 3 :Eu:Mn (green color) BaMg 2 Al 19 O 27 :Eu (blue color).
  • fluorescent materials which is excited at ultraviolet ray of short wavelength (254 nm) may include, for example, trade name Lumilux® CD-770(green color, 530 nm) of Honeywell company and trade name IPO-18(green color, 530 nm) of DAYGLO's company, and a chemical composition is Zn 2 SiO 4 :Mn (green color), CaY 0.8 Tb 0.1 AlO 4 (green color, US 2006/0055307A1). Therefore, functionality can be maximized with a differential application of the said pigment to the first ingredient and the second ingredient of fibers.
  • infrared ray pigment While it is not restrictive for infrared ray pigment to render functionality to composite fibers of the present invention, it may be preferable to use those whose heat resistance is excellent up to extent not to change its property at melting point of selected synthetic high molecules for fibers, and infrared ray absorbing agent such as imminiumes compound, diimminiumes compound, aminiumes compound, polymethines compound and phthalocyanine compound may be preferably used.
  • the products of the said infrared ray pigment is, for example, epolight 1117(component: Tetrakisamminium, color: brown, maximum absorbing wavelength: 1071 nm), epolight 3045(component: Nickel dithiolene, color: black grey, maximum absorbing wavelength: 1097 nm) of Epolin compony, USA, and IR-820(component: Ploymethine, color: green, maximum absorbing wavelength: 820 nm) of Nippon chemical, Japan, which may be available with being mixed with high molecules for fibers and have an excellent heat resistance.
  • epolight 1117 component: Tetrakisamminium, color: brown, maximum absorbing wavelength: 1071 nm
  • epolight 3045 component: Nickel dithiolene, color: black grey, maximum absorbing wavelength: 1097 nm
  • IR-820 component: Ploymethine, color: green, maximum absorbing wavelength: 820 nm
  • the present invention can be achieved with obtainment of composite fibers of side by side type by mixing colored pigment, fluorescent pigment, infrared ray pigment and the like to synthetic high molecules of the first ingredient and the second ingredient and then melt-spinning, and functionality is variously displayed such as visual effect, fluorescent effect and infrared ray effect from a monofilament of one strand according to mixing condition.
  • fibers are prepared by containing colored pigment to the first ingredient and containing invisible fluorescent pigment to the second ingredient, functional effect is expressed such that color by colored pigment is displayed under visual ray and color emitting light by fluorescent pigment is displayed under ultraviolet ray.
  • Such functional effect may be variously displayed according to parameter combining the first ingredient, the second ingredient and a special pigment constituting fibers.

  • the functional fiber for preventing forgery to achieve the other object of the present invention may be produced by preparing the composite fibers having a cross section of a side by side type by melting and spinning a master batch of at least two kinds obtained by mixing a functional pigment to resins which have different melting point each other, and then by heat treating at thermal deformable temperature of the said resins.
  • thermal deformable temperature means measured temperature at when high molecules is deformed when rising temperature at a constant velocity while applying a constant load on high molecules.
  • the composite fibers of side by side type, a constituent element of the present invention may be produced by using a conventional well-known art, which may be produced by melting and spinning a master batch of two kinds or more being mixed a functional pigment to at least one resin whose dissolving temperature is different through one nozzle such that fibers has a cross section being attached with a side by side type.
  • the fibers having a cross section of a side by side type produced with the said method take a deformation such as bowing or crooking and the like since resins are extended and contracted according to a physical property of resins including melting temperature and molecular weight when being heated to thermal deformable temperature of the said resins and cooled. Therefore, the present invention can provide fibers of particular form by using the said property.
  • fibers are produced by using the resins that have more high melting temperature as resins of the first master batch, and the resins that have more low melting temperature as resins of the second master batch, and the produced fibers turn a monofilament.
  • the fibers are crooked toward a direction of component of the second master batch with heat treatment by difference of contraction and expansion.
  • the fibers produced by combining resins of different kind as the first master batch and the second master batch respectively are crooked by difference of contraction and expansion according to melting property of each high molecules.
  • the said resins it is preferable for the said resins to have melting property. It is preferable for the said resins to use at least one selected from polyester, nylon, polypropylene, polyethylene and polyurethane which are molten by heating at high temperature and solidified by returning to low temperature for the said melt-spinning.
